Our client, is a leading supplier and manufacturer of SMC & BMC materials across Europe.
They are seeking a Lab Technician to join their dynamic team. Based in Burnley, you will play a pivotal role in supporting the smooth and efficient running of their manufacturing and logistics processes.
This is a permanent position offering a competitive salary of between £26,000 to £28,000.
Responsibilities- Ensuring the prompt testing and booking in of conforming and non-conforming raw materials, the testing of conforming and non-conforming finished goods
- Collating and documenting the results
- Reviewing the results to identify any trends
- Escalating any variation with all data and details needed for decision making
- Ensuring the prompt identification and reporting operational trends and functional performance
- Maintaining the schedule of work based on the requirements of the Operations team and the delivery schedule.
The Laboratory Technician will typically be responsible for the following tests:
- Karl Fisher Titration
- Viscosity
- Penetration testing
- Impact, Flexural and Tensile strength.
- Particle size
- Photo spectrometer colour testing
- Resistivity
- Basic Di-Electric Analysis
